English Organ Music of the 18th and 19th centuries contains a selection of voluntaries and other pieces by composers ranging from John Stanley to Samuel Wesley. Mainly for manuals only, this collection provides a rich variety of baroque and classical organ music and is ideal for organists needing easier repertoire for regular church services.
